Parts of far Western Maryland along with Grant and Pendleton counties in West Virginia, are under a Blizzard Warning until 10 a.m. today. Forecasters say up to a foot of snow is possible on the higher slopes of western Garrett County, with winds up to 50 miles an hour creating whiteout conditions. Eastern Garrett County is under a Winter Weather Advisory, with two to five inches of snow and gusts near 45 miles an hour. Travel could be treacherous this morning, and officials urge drivers to stay off the roads unless it’s an emergency.
